Top 5 Boat Games on Android in Oceania - Q3 2021

The third quarter of 2021 saw notable performance among the top boat games on the Android platform in Oceania. Here’s a detailed look at the weekly downloads, revenue, and active user trends for the top 5 boat games.

Flippy Race from Ketchapp showed a significant increase in weekly revenue, peaking at $89 in the week of August 2. Weekly downloads also saw a spike, reaching 3.4K in the same week, while weekly active users climbed to 6.8K. However, both downloads and active users experienced a decline towards the end of the quarter.

Port City: Ship Tycoon from Pixel Federation Games had a steady rise in weekly revenue, culminating at $614 in the final week of September. Weekly downloads remained consistent, with a peak of 990 in the week of August 23, and active users grew gradually, peaking at 1.3K in late September.

Submarine Jump! by Kwalee Ltd saw moderate weekly downloads, peaking at 985 in the week of August 2. Active users reached a high of 2K in the week of August 9 but gradually decreased to 947 by the end of the quarter.

Battle of Warships: Online from MobileGDC experienced a steady revenue stream, with a peak of $751 in the week of July 5. Weekly downloads showed a gradual increase, peaking at 422 in the week of August 23. Active users consistently hovered around 1.3K throughout the quarter.

Hyper Boat by Suji Games maintained a consistent download rate, peaking at 439 in the week of September 6. Active users also showed a steady increase, peaking at 318 in the same week.
